The Rise of Mini Rice Harvesters Transforming Agriculture
In recent years, the agricultural landscape has undergone significant changes, largely driven by technological advancements and the growing need for efficiency in farming practices. One such innovation that has made a considerable impact is the mini rice harvester. These compact machines are revolutionizing the way rice is harvested, especially in smallholder farms across Asia and other rice-growing regions.
Mini rice harvesters are specifically designed to cater to the needs of small farmers who own limited land. Traditional harvesting methods often involve labor-intensive processes, leading to increased costs and time consumption. These compact machines, however, offer a solution that is both efficient and cost-effective. With their ability to maneuver easily through narrow fields and their efficiency in harvesting crops, mini rice harvesters have quickly become an essential tool for enhancing productivity in rice farming.
One of the most significant advantages of mini rice harvesters is their ability to drastically reduce the time required for harvesting. In many regions, rice harvesting is a race against time, as delays can result in crop losses due to over-ripening or adverse weather conditions. These machines can complete the harvest in a fraction of the time it would take manual laborers, providing farmers the opportunity to harvest their crops at the optimal moment. This not only maximizes yield but also reduces post-harvest losses, which is a critical concern for small-scale farmers.
Moreover, mini rice harvesters come with the added benefit of minimizing labor costs. In many developing countries, labor shortages and rising wages have posed significant challenges for farmers. By utilizing a mini rice harvester, farmers can significantly reduce their dependency on labor while still achieving high efficiency. This shift not only leads to cost savings but also allows farmers to reallocate their resources toward other critical areas of their farms.
